We all need help. Moses needed to sit down with Aaron and Hur either side of him to keep his arms aloft in prayer less their army was defeated. Even Mary asks children (usually) to help her. Our Lady asked three shepherd children in Fatima to help with the conversion of sinners and to obtain peace. Mary also asked St Bernadette to visit her every day for two weeks in Lourdes.
It is not possible to do the will of God on our own or without God's grace.
St Bernadette's relics are visiting our diocese this coming week. We can ask for her help as we try to be faithful and "dedicated" to God as she was. Please try to visit one of the three places. St Bernadette was pleased that Mary asked her to help. After the little saint left Lourdes for a hidden life in Nevers, she said that, like a broom, Mary had used her and now placed her back behind the door.
In order for us to be "equipped and ready for any good work" we need perseverance. We need to persevere in prayer and to keep asking the Just Judge for all we need to keep faithful, grow in faith and to do His will.
How beautiful to ask God each day: "Let me help you Lord and change me to help you!" May St Bernadette and St Philip Howard pray for us and help us too.
